Plagiarism is a crime, flat out. It is unethical and immoral to copy, verbatim, another persons work and claim it as your own, especially for scholastic uses. In order to avoid plagiarism, it is important that we give accurate references and paraphrase, rather that copy and paste information. It is important to consider the widespread effect of plagiarism. It effects all involved: The student, the owner of the information, the instructor, and even the site from which the information was stolen. Use the proper channels and be honest when completing assignments goes a long way. We must do what we can to prevent plagiarism, starting with ourselves and our own research. <span />
